A series of novel benzofuran-isoxazole 7a–7j hybrid heterocyclic molecules are synthesized. The structures of compounds 7a–7j are assessed by IR, NMR, MASS spectroscopy and elemental analysis. The target compounds 7a–7j are screened for their antibacterial activity and demonstrated excellent to moderate activity against gram-positive and gram-negative bacteria.
